Mak Name Meaning
Chinese : Cantonese variant of Mai 2. Polish and Ukrainian: from a short form of the personal name Makary, Makar, or some other Slavic form of the Greek personal name Makarios ‘blessed’. Polish, Jewish (Ashkenazic), and Slovienian: from mak ‘poppy’, a nickname for someone who grew poppies or (as a Jewish name) an ornamental name. Hungarian (Mák): from Mák, a short form of the ecclesistical personal name Makár, Hungarian form of Greek Makarios ‘blessed’. Dutch: variant of Mack 2 and 3.
Source: Dictionary of American Family Names ©2013, Oxford University Press
